  • The Uncontrolling Love of God: An Open and Relational Account of Providence By Thomas Jay Oord
    An influential work in modern theology, specifically within the "Open Theism" and "Relational Theology" circles. Oord argues that God's nature is essentially self-giving, sacrificial love (agape), which means God cannot control others—not because He lacks power, but because love, by its very nature, grants freedom.
